Sean "Diddy" Combs' attorney is saying they reached out to Donald Trump regarding a presidential pardon. The music mogul was found guilty for two prostitution-related offenses, but was acquitted of sex trafficking and racketeering conspiracy charges. Combs is currently in prison, awaiting sentencing.
